If it's definitely a UK model then it will have the Exynos CPU, but i would also want clarification.

It's very easy to find out, with an app CPU-Z or AIDA64, so the fact they haven't done that, rings alarm bells.

As you say it could be a handset from anywhere otherwise and not a UK/global model.
